Up for sale is my Nottingham Analogue Hyperspace , comes with the following
2 armpods ( 12” Jelco and 9” NAS or rega fit)
Also have the rear leg that was removed to turn it into a 2 arm deck (very easy to revert back)
Wave mechanic PSU
Jelco SA-750LB 12” tonearm boxed
Ammonite audio upgraded Jelco collar
Jelco JAC-501 tonearm cable
Ortofon Jubilee moving coil cartridge boxed
Bottle of NA bearing oil
Note- the chrome arm in the pics is not included and neither is the carbon fibre headshell , it will come with the Jelco headshell
All in great condition , always been stored under large acrylic cover

Fully insured postage at buyers costYou're taking a massive risk posting this, unless you can package it and drop it onto concrete from 1m high then forget it, and I'm not making that up it's pretty much an industry minimum standard for couriers.
By the time you pack it to withstand that drop no one will be able to pick it up easily which in turn makes it liable to be dropped.
That's why you see lots of turntable sellers all the buyer to organise the courier as it's the buyer that then had to deal with any delivery hassles.

When I got my TT back from Notts analogue, they packed it in a very thick large cardboard box with the tonearm in the same box but obviously wrapped separately, I don't think NA decks are fragile at all, not being suspended. I think they charged me £25 for the box, which was made of cardboard so thick it was very rigid.
